Direct quote from CERN, where they both predicted and discovered the boson (emphasis mine):

Since every particle can be represented as a wave in a quantum field, introducing a new field into the theory means that a particle associated with this field should also exist.

Most properties of this particle are predicted by the theory, so if a particle matching the description would be found, it provides strong evidence for the BEH mechanism – otherwise we have no means of probing for the existence of the Higgs field.

The properties they were looking for were predicted by Higgs’ initial theory. The only unknown property was the specific mass but, as I’ve mentioned and you confirmed, they knew a range. Every other property of it was already known. If he was wrong, they wouldn’t have found anything. They knew what tests they needed to do because they knew what properties they were looking for. In this case, a boson with a large mass, within a large range, that quickly decays. The only reason it took so long to observe using these tests was because the lifetime of the particle is so short which means it cannot be found in nature.
